The cost of a paternity test in the UK can vary depending on various factors, including the type of test chosen, the number of individuals being tested, the location of the testing facility, and whether the test is for personal or legal purposes The two main types of paternity tests are home DNA testing kits and legal DNA testing.
Home DNA testing kits are cheaper and more accessible, with prices ranging from £99 to £299 These kits can be ordered online or purchased over the counter at pharmacies However, it’s essential to note that results from home DNA testing kits may not be admissible in court or for official purposes.
On the other hand, legal DNA testing is more expensive due to the stringent procedures followed to ensure accuracy and reliability Legal paternity tests cost between £299 and £699, depending on the testing facility and the number of individuals being tested Legal paternity tests require individuals to visit a registered testing facility, where samples are collected by a professional to prevent tampering or contamination.

Testing the alleged father and child is standard practice for paternity tests, but additional individuals can be included in the test for an extra fee Testing the mother is recommended but not always necessary, as the child inherits DNA from both parents.
The location of the testing facility can also influence the cost of a paternity test in the UK Testing facilities in major cities may charge higher prices due to the cost of operations and overheads It’s advisable to compare prices from different testing facilities to ensure that you’re getting the best value for your money.
If the paternity test is required for legal purposes, such as child maintenance, immigration, or inheritance claims, the cost may be higher due to the additional documentation and certification required Legal DNA testing involves strict chain of custody procedures to ensure that the results are admissible in court.
When considering the cost of a paternity test in the UK, it’s essential to look beyond the price and consider the quality and accuracy of the test Cheaper tests may not provide the same level of accuracy as more expensive tests, so it’s crucial to choose a reputable testing facility with a proven track record of delivering reliable results.
